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> Qt и кроссплатформенное программирование С/С++
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 03.11.2008, 19:17   #1
Diman2008
Пользователь
 
Регистрация: 16.01.2008
Сообщений: 37
По умолчанию Компиляция в Qt

Привет ! Установил Qt вроде как все правильно сделал по инструкции. Начал изучать книгу там написано скомплируйте прогру в командной строке. В той папке где лежит файл 'test.cpp' задаю команду qmake -project 'test.cpp' и на этом ничего не происходит. Подскажите как правильно компилировать ?
Diman2008 вне форума Ответить с цитированием
Старый 04.11.2008, 04:38   #2
Min
Форумчанин
 
Регистрация: 12.09.2008
Сообщений: 239
По умолчанию

после "qmake -project test.cpp" у тебя создаётся файл с расширением ".pro"....... допустим его имя тоже "test.pro" тогда тебе нужно выполнить "qmake test.pro"...... после этого создастся файл "makefile"....... просто выполняешь "make"..... все)))
Надо бы избавиться от привычки ставить многоточие.....
Min вне форума Ответить с цитированием
Старый 04.11.2008, 11:33   #3
Diman2008
Пользователь
 
Регистрация: 16.01.2008
Сообщений: 37
По умолчанию

После qmake -project в командной строке ничего не появляется. Файла .pro нету
Diman2008 вне форума Ответить с цитированием
Старый 04.11.2008, 12:44   #4
alexinspir
Новичок
Джуниор
 
Аватар для alexinspir
 
Регистрация: 26.08.2008
Сообщений: 1,010
По умолчанию

Цитата:
Сообщение от Diman2008 Посмотреть сообщение
После qmake -project в командной строке ничего не появляется. Файла .pro нету
надо в path в командной строке прописать директорию, где у тебя находится qmake.exe и директорию где у тебя mingw32-make.exe
ромик0: Cколько получают здешние модераторы?
pu4koff: У модераторов сдельная оплата труда. Выдал предупреждение - плюс к премии. Выдал бан - лучший модератор месяца со всеми вытекающими.
alexinspir вне форума Ответить с цитированием
Старый 04.11.2008, 13:14   #5
Diman2008
Пользователь
 
Регистрация: 16.01.2008
Сообщений: 37
По умолчанию

Спасибо получилось ! только вот почему то с книги по Qt4 пример не компилируется там выделяется память опирацией new:
этот код выдает ошибки
Код:
#include <QtGui>
int main (int argc, char** argv)
{
QApplication app(argc,argv);
QLabel label= new QLabel("Hello"); // здесь почемуто ошибка
label.show();
return app.exec();
}
а этот компилирутеся
Код:
#include <QtGui>
int main (int argc, char** argv)
{
QApplication app(argc,argv);
QLabel label ("Hello"); 
label.show();
return app.exec();
}
Diman2008 вне форума Ответить с цитированием
Старый 05.11.2008, 10:57   #6
Min
Форумчанин
 
Регистрация: 12.09.2008
Сообщений: 239
По умолчанию

QLabel*label=new QLabel("hello");
Надо бы избавиться от привычки ставить многоточие.....
Min вне форума Ответить с цитированием
Старый 16.11.2008, 20:57   #7
BOBAH13
Android Developer
Старожил Подтвердите свой е-майл
 
Аватар для BOBAH13
 
Регистрация: 19.02.2007
Сообщений: 3,708
По умолчанию

Прошу прощения... но вот понять не могу... собираю MinGW + QT4 в среде Code::Blocks... хелоу ворлды собираются... но как только объявил свой класс от QWidget все.. вылетела ошибка undefined reference to `vtable for Preview'| и в таком же духе.. ну Preview мой класс. Сосбтвенно видел что надо через moc собирать но может как то можно настроить Code::Blocks я не давно начала изучения Qt4.

p.s. убрал Q_OBJECT все собралось )) но это ведь не нормально...

ладно ясно ))) нашел ответ вот тут http://vsu.front.ru/ отличная информация... все заработало

Последний раз редактировалось BOBAH13; 16.11.2008 в 22:46.
BOBAH13 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
??? release компиляция Assassin Общие вопросы C/C++ 1 26.09.2008 02:57
Компиляция. Бро Общие вопросы C/C++ 2 03.06.2008 06:46
Компиляция SQl процедур nimf БД в Delphi 7 18.04.2008 23:27
Компиляция xGroupers Общие вопросы Delphi 1 24.03.2008 11:57
Компиляция Lonix Общие вопросы Delphi 2 16.09.2007 16:22